2016-17: Rowed to a pair of wins at the Big Ten Double Dual with the second novice eight (4/8) … helped the fifth novice collegiate eight to fifth place at the 2016 Head of the Rock (10/9)
High School: Competed in swimming for three years and earned three varsity letters … 2015 varsity co-captain … also competed in track and field for three years, earning three varsity letters
Personal: Parents are Teresa Fischer and Craig Gorst … has one sister, Ashley
Reason for choosing UW-Madison: “Growing up I always loved Madison athletics and both my parents graduated here, so the Badgers were part of the family. The strong academics and beautiful campus also made it a place to call home.”
What Wisconsin rowing means to you: “Wisconsin rowing means being challenged every day to work hard, improve, and compete as a Badger; all with my teammates and coaches right alongside of me.”
